[Pkg-voip-commits] r2362 - in asterisk/trunk/debian: . patches
Tzafrir Cohen
tzafrir-guest at costa.debian.org
Sun Sep 10 00:00:42 UTC 2006
Author: tzafrir-guest
Date: 2006-09-10 00:00:39 +0000 (Sun, 10 Sep 2006)
New Revision: 2362
Modified:
asterisk/trunk/debian/changelog
asterisk/trunk/debian/patches/00list
asterisk/trunk/debian/patches/bristuff.dpatch
Log:
* asterisk 1.2.12
* bristuff.dpatch: version adapted.
* apprecord_sprintf.dpatch removed: already applied.
Modified: asterisk/trunk/debian/changelog
===================================================================
--- asterisk/trunk/debian/changelog 2006-09-09 23:56:19 UTC (rev 2361)
+++ asterisk/trunk/debian/changelog 2006-09-10 00:00:39 UTC (rev 2362)
@@ -1,8 +1,11 @@
-asterisk (1:1.2.11.dfsg-2) UNRELEASED; urgency=low
+asterisk (1:1.2.12.dfsg-1) UNRELEASED; urgency=low
* NOT RELEASED YET
+ * New upstream release
+ * bristuff.dpatch: version adapted.
+ * apprecord_sprintf.dpatch removed: already applied.
- -- Mark Purcell <msp at debian.org> Sat, 2 Sep 2006 20:00:22 +0100
+ -- Tzafrir Cohen <tzafrir.cohen at xorcom.com> Sun, 10 Sep 2006 01:13:08 +0300
asterisk (1:1.2.11.dfsg-1) unstable; urgency=high
Modified: asterisk/trunk/debian/patches/00list
===================================================================
--- asterisk/trunk/debian/patches/00list 2006-09-09 23:56:19 UTC (rev 2361)
+++ asterisk/trunk/debian/patches/00list 2006-09-10 00:00:39 UTC (rev 2362)
@@ -17,4 +17,3 @@
correct_pid_display
zap_restart
backport_playdtmf
-apprecord_sprintf
Modified: asterisk/trunk/debian/patches/bristuff.dpatch
===================================================================
--- asterisk/trunk/debian/patches/bristuff.dpatch 2006-09-09 23:56:19 UTC (rev 2361)
+++ asterisk/trunk/debian/patches/bristuff.dpatch 2006-09-10 00:00:39 UTC (rev 2362)
@@ -10,8 +10,8 @@
--- asterisk-1.2.10.orig/.version 2006-07-14 23:29:33.000000000 +0200
+++ asterisk-1.2.10/.version 2006-07-31 14:13:27.000000000 +0200
@@ -1 +1 @@
--1.2.11
-+1.2.11-BRIstuffed-0.3.0-PRE-1s
+-1.2.12
++1.2.12-BRIstuffed-0.3.0-PRE-1s
diff -urN asterisk-1.2.10.orig/HARDWARE asterisk-1.2.10/HARDWARE
--- asterisk-1.2.10.orig/HARDWARE 2005-11-29 19:24:39.000000000 +0100
+++ asterisk-1.2.10/HARDWARE 2006-07-31 14:13:08.000000000 +0200
@@ -8533,7 +8533,7 @@
/* Make sure extension exists (or in overlap dial mode, can exist) */
if ((pri->overlapdial && ast_canmatch_extension(NULL, pri->pvts[chanpos]->context, pri->pvts[chanpos]->exten, 1, pri->pvts[chanpos]->cid_num)) ||
ast_exists_extension(NULL, pri->pvts[chanpos]->context, pri->pvts[chanpos]->exten, 1, pri->pvts[chanpos]->cid_num)) {
-@@ -8464,22 +9293,38 @@
+@@ -8464,23 +9293,39 @@
res = zt_setlaw(pri->pvts[chanpos]->subs[SUB_REAL].zfd, law);
if (res < 0)
ast_log(LOG_WARNING, "Unable to set law on channel %d\n", pri->pvts[chanpos]->channel);
@@ -8545,12 +8545,13 @@
+ }
if (res < 0)
ast_log(LOG_WARNING, "Unable to set gains on channel %d\n", pri->pvts[chanpos]->channel);
-- if (e->ring.complete || !pri->overlapdial)
+- if (e->ring.complete || !pri->overlapdial) {
+ if ((pri->nodetype != BRI_NETWORK_PTMP) && (pri->nodetype != BRI_NETWORK)) {
+ if (e->ring.complete || !pri->overlapdial) {
/* Just announce proceeding */
+ pri->pvts[chanpos]->proceeding = 1;
pri_proceeding(pri->pri, e->ring.call, PVT_TO_CHANNEL(pri->pvts[chanpos]), 0);
-- else {
+- } else {
+ // pri->pvts[chanpos]->ignoredtmf = 0;
+ } else {
if (pri->switchtype != PRI_SWITCH_GR303_TMC)
@@ -13429,7 +13430,7 @@
int pid;
char *stringp;
AGI agi;
-@@ -2041,15 +2117,18 @@
+@@ -2041,16 +2117,19 @@
}
}
#endif
@@ -13442,7 +13443,8 @@
+ agi.audio_out = efd;
+ agi.audio_in = efd2;
res = run_agi(chan, argv[0], &agi, pid, dead);
- close(fds[1]);
+ if (fds[1] != fds[0])
+ close(fds[1]);
if (efd > -1)
close(efd);
+ if (efd2 > -1)
More information about the Pkg-voip-commits
mailing list